2005 Transportation Profiles

American Community Survey: 2005 Transportation Profile1

By Place of Work

Geographic Area1: Beaumont city, Texas

Download an Excel file* of this document: beaumont_city_texas.xls.

W1. SELECTED CHARACTERISTICS, 1990, 2000, 2005

Selected Characteristics1 1990 2000 2005 ACS 2005 ACS MOE3
  Includes GQ Pop Does not include GQ Pop
Total Persons 114,323 113,866 x x
Total Persons in Household 110,769 110,797 107,876 x
Total Workers, Place of Residence 47,942 46,571 45,152 3,760
Total Workers, Place of Work 65,081 68,555 65,889 4,360
Employment-Residence Ratio 1.36 1.47 1.46 0.17

W2. MODE TO WORK1

  1990 2000 2005 ACS Sig. Diff. In Percents2000-2005
Includes GQ pop Does not include GQ Pop
Number Percent Number Percent MOE (%) Number Percent MOE (%)
Total Workers 65,081 100.0 68,555 100.0 NA 65,889 100.0 NA NA
Drove alone 53,152 81.7 57,430 83.8 0.7 55,199 83.8 1.7 No
2-person carpool 6,901 10.6 6,230 9.1 0.5 5,303 8.0 2.6 No
3-person carpool 1,031 1.6 1,240 1.8 0.2 892 1.4 0.7 No
4-or-more-person carpool 578 0.9 600 0.9 0.2 1,704 2.6 1.9 No
Public Transportation 655 1.0 640 0.9 0.2 312 0.5 0.5 No
Walked 1,183 1.8 730 1.1 0.2 823 1.2 1.1 No
Taxicab, motorcycle, bike or other 837 1.3 760 1.1 0.2 1,156 1.8 1.0 No
Worked at home 744 1.1 930 1.4 0.2 500 0.8 0.5 Yes
